第二周KeyResult1:通过petalinux构建uboot kernel fs

本文介绍了如何通过petalinux构建板级系统,首先分析板级电路配置,包括PS和PL部分,接着详细阐述创建片上系统的过程,如创建vivado工程、构建ARM A9核并配置外设IO引脚,最后导出硬件定义文件,为后续在petaLinux上配置boot、kernel和fs打下基础。
摘要由CSDN通过智能技术生成

在通过petalinux构建整个板级系统之前,先看一下板卡上的硬件配置。

1、板级电路配置

先看总的原理框图,主要看板卡上的基础配置,以及引出来的外设部分。

图片引用ALinx的文档。

1.1 PS部分

 

PS时钟
序号 名称 型号 个数 备注
1 外部晶振 33.33333MHz 有源晶振 1 与PS端的PS_CLK_500引脚连接
PS端调试
序号 名称 型号 个数 备注
1 调试与下载 FT232HL 1

FTDI 的 USB 桥接芯片
实现PC与ZYNQ的JTAG调试信号引脚TCK,TDO,TMS,TDI 进行数据通信。

在开发阶段,这么做确实很方便。

PS外设配置
序号 名称 型号 个数 备注
1 DDR3内存

H5TQ4G63CFR

海力士

2

4Gbit*2=8Gbit

总共1GB的内存。

总线宽度32bit

最高速率533MHz

2 Flash存储

W25Q256

winbond

1

256MBit

总共32MB的spi flash

3 SD卡

TXS026

电平转换芯片

1  
4 串口

CP2102

Silicon Labs

1  
5 网卡

RTL8211E

Realtek

1

10/100/1000M自适应以太网

RGMII接口

6 USB

MINI USB

USB TYPEA

2  
7 PS MIO   12 预留出了12个引脚
8 PS KEY   2 按下按键,信号为低;松开按键,信号为高
9 PS LED   2
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值